21st Century Partnership of Middle Georgia Inc, founded in 2002, is a micro nonprofit that reported $35K in total revenue in fiscal year 2021. Revenue fell 92% from the prior year — a significant decline worth monitoring. Expenses of $188K exceeded revenue, resulting in a 429% operating deficit.

Mission

Provides support for the operation of Robins Air Force Base (RAFB).
